I joined Times Radio’s Maddie Hale on Tuesday for a 30-minute analysis of Donald Trump’s latest flip-flop over Vladimir Putin’s invasion of Ukraine.

On Monday Trump called for defensive weapons to Ukraine as the Pentagon undid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th’s suspension of aid to Kyiv. After his Thursday call with Putin and Friday’s with Ukraine Presiden Volodymyr Zelensky, Trump criticized the Russian leader for continuing deadly attacks, particularly on Ukrainian civilians.

But does Trump finally realize that Putin will not accept a genuine ceasefire and give up his ambition to conquer Ukraine? And there are enough “adults in the room” in the Administration to firmly establish US support of Ukrainian resistance?
